Gửi bài giải
Điểm:
1,00 (OI)
Giới hạn thời gian:
1.0s
Giới hạn bộ nhớ:
256M
Input:
stdin
Output:
stdout
Tác giả:
Dạng bài
Ngôn ngữ cho phép
Python, Scratch
Các bạn học sinh tiểu học rất thích các dấu hiệu nhận biết số chia hết. Ban tổ chức quyết định đưa ra hai số ~N~ và ~M~. Thí sinh nào tìm ra số ~A~ lớn nhất được tạo bởi các chữ số của ~N~ mà chia hết cho số ~M~ (~M~ là số chẵn từ ~2~ đến ~10~) thì sẽ nhận được một bánh trung thu in logo của cuộc thi cho mỗi câu hỏi.
Dữ liệu
- Nhập vào hai số tự nhiên ~N~, ~M~ ~(2 ≤ 𝑀 ≤ 10, 𝑀~ là số chẵn~)~, mỗi số ghi trên một dòng.
Kết quả
- Ghi ra số ~A~ lớn nhất tạo được thỏa mãn yêu cầu của bài toán. Nếu không có số nào thỏa mãn thì ghi ra ~0~.
Chấm điểm:
- Nếu chương trình chạy đúng những trường hợp ~1 ≤ N ≤ 1000~, thí sinh sẽ được ~40~ điểm;
- Nếu chương trình chạy đúng những trường hợp ~1 ≤ 𝑁 ≤ 10^{15}~ thí sinh sẽ được ~100~ điểm.
Sample Input 1
324
2
Sample Output 1
432
Note
- Có nhiều số ~A~ tạo thành từ ~N~ chia hết cho ~2~ như ~324, 234, 432, 342~ nhưng số lớn nhất là ~432~.
Sample Input 2
16
6
Sample Output 2
0
Note
- Chỉ có ~2~ số ~A~ có thể tạo thành từ ~N~ là ~16~ và ~61~ đều không chia hết cho ~6~.
Bình luận